KALAMAZOO, MI (WKZO AM/FM) – Bronson Health Foundation has named Kalamazoo native Amy Routhier as senior director of major gifts and legacy giving.
Routhier will help expand donor engagement and philanthropic support for patient care, healthcare innovation and community health across southwest Michigan.
She most recently served as vice president for institutional advancement at Albion College. She has also held senior leadership roles at Western Michigan University, where she provided strategic leadership for recruitment, enrollment, marketing, outreach and program expansion of the university’s regional location and online credit activities.
A leader in higher education advancement and community partnership, Routhier brings experience building fundraising teams, cultivating donor relationships, and connecting people with purposeful causes. In this role, she will lead major gifts, planned giving, legacy giving and grateful patient fundraising as part of a growing team focused on deepening donor relationships and expanding philanthropic partnerships throughout the region.
Routhier joins the Foundation as Bronson Healthcare celebrates 125 years of service as the region’s largest health system and employer. Her leadership comes at a pivotal time as Bronson Health Foundation expands its philanthropy team to deepen donor engagement, strengthen community partnerships and amplify the impact of charitable giving.
